In my profession I very often come across people who refuse to see how having an online presence can be of any benefit to their business. Their reasons and logics vary and many a times exceed mine!

I strongly believe that every business should have an identify online. People's excuses for not having a website revolves around logics like, their business is way too small to go online, or that they don’t sell products, just offer services like carpet cleaning and plumbing, or that they have had a website before and it was very expensive, and the one of the more common reason  is that they have never needed to advertise, and that they generate enough orders to keep them going through word of mouth, and therefore they wouldn't consider having a website for their business.

A website is an important tool for many reasons. First, it can save you time. Whether it is a  simple one page site describing products and services you offer or a hi-tech e-commerce site, that enables your target customers to read and review of your products, it saves your time. And where small businesses are concerned websites help you connect with a far wider and varied audience than some of us can even envisage.

A website also saves you money – It is a great tool to market your products/ services from a more effective platform, and to a much wider audience. Many small businesses after getting a website have observed an upward surge in turnover.

A well written, informative website, can definitely generate better business than any  traditional methods of advertising like leaflets, Yellow Pages etc can. Gone are the days when people looked at yellow pages to find a local mechanic. Now typing ‘Mechanics in Sydney’ into Google takes them to hundreds of website detailing the service. I would like all small business owners to understand this and also that the initial cost of having an effective website may seem high at first but once the business starts rolling in they will know the real power of the investment they have made..

Another reason to get a website is because your competitors have one. If your competitor has a website and you don't then you may be indirectly promoting his business.  People looking for your services online will find your competitor's website but not yours. So you lose out!  If you do not have a website then your competitors is facing less competition on the net, which in turn means a higher percentage of searches for your products or services will ultimately be directed to their website.

A well designed website with a unique USP helps a business grow like nothing does. A website is your first point of contact with potential customers, and you don’t get a second chance to make a first impression. An attractive, easy to use website will help to convey that confidence to your costumers online. The internet has leveled the playing field, and we can compete against market leaders, without  spending on advertising and self promotion.

I personally feel brochures are often quite costly to produce, and the information quickly becoming out of date. Where as once your website has been produced, changing information such as prices can easily be done, for a fraction of the cost of printing a new brochure.
